android 编译mupdf,Android mupdf在Ubuntu下的编译教程(最详细的教程)

本文提供了一篇关于如何在Ubuntu操作系统中编译Android版mupdf框架的详细教程。首先介绍了mupdf的基本信息,然后讲解了Ubuntu的安装、NDK环境配置,接着详细阐述了从官网或GitHub下载mupdf源码,通过make generate命令进行编译的过程,以及在编译过程中可能出现的问题和解决办法。最后,指导读者修改local.properties文件以设置NDK路径,并通过ndk-build命令完成编译,生成.so文件。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

mupdf是一个国外的打开pdf的开源框架,就不多做介绍了,直接入正题。

一、Ubuntu的安装(网上很多教程)

二、Ubuntu下安装ndk环境(网上很多教程)

三、mupdf的源码获取方式:

1.MuPdf官网下载,地址: https://mupdf.com/downloads/archive/,选择一个你需要的地址下载,我这里下载的是:mupdf-1.6-source.tar.gz

2.github源码下载,自己安装Git工具。mupdf的github地址为:https://github.com/muennich/mupdf

四、源码编译:

1.把下载的mupdf源码放到桌面:

0818b9ca8b590ca3270a3433284dd417.png

2.使用make generate命令。

使用命令之前:

0818b9ca8b590ca3270a3433284dd417.png

3.编译:

dzh@ubuntu:~$ cd /home/dzh/Desktop/mupdf-1.6-source

dzh@ubuntu:~/Desktop/mupdf-1.6-source$ make generate

Package x11 was not found in the pkg-config search path.

Perhaps you should add the directory containing `x11.

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值